Effect of Sleep on Metabolic rate



Lack of rest can dramatically decrease your metabolic rate and impede your weight loss development. When you do not get enough sleep, your body's capability to control h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interrupted. This discrepancy can lead to enhanced appetite, food cravings for junk foods, and a reduction in the variety of calories your body burns at rest.

Research has revealed that sleep deprival can alter your metabolic process in a way that makes it tougher to drop we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body has a tendency to keep fat stores and burn fewer calories, making it more difficult to produce the calorie deficiency required for weight-loss. Furthermore, inadequate rest can influence your power levels and inspiration to workout, further preventing your progress in the direction of your weight reduction objectives.



To sustain your metabolic process and weight-loss efforts, focus on obtaining 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. By enhancing your sleep behaviors, you can improve your body's ability to regulate hormones, boost metabolic rate, and sustain your weight loss trip.

Impact of Sleep on Hunger Hormones



Obtaining adequate rest plays a vital role in regulating hunger hormonal agents, impacting your hunger and food selections. When you don't obtain sufficient sleep, it can disrupt the balance of key hormones that control appetite and satiation, causing enhanced yearnings and over-eating.

Below's how rest affects your appetite hormonal agents:

- ** Leptin Degrees **: Rest starvation can reduce leptin levels, the hormone in charge of signifying volume to your brain. When leptin levels are low, you may feel hungrier and less completely satisfied after consuming.

- ** Ghrelin Levels **: Lack of sleep has a tendency to enhance ghrelin degrees, the hormonal agent that stimulates cravings. Elevated ghrelin degrees can make you long for much more high-calorie foods, leading to possible weight gain.

- ** Insulin Level Of Sensitivity **: Poor sleep can decrease insulin level of sensitivity, making it harder for your body to control blood sugar level degrees. This can lead to increased hunger and a higher threat of creating insulin resistance.
